One of the primary considerations when purchasing a Multi-Lane Feeding Yamaha Feeder is the type of materials it will handle. Understanding the nature of the products is crucial, as different materials may require unique handling capabilities. Buyers should assess the feeder's adaptability to various shapes, weights, and sizes, ensuring that it can accommodate your product range. Additionally, it's essential to evaluate the feeder’s compatibility with existing machinery, as seamless integration will significantly enhance operational efficiency.

Cost is always a key factor in purchasing decisions, and while Multi-Lane Feeding Yamaha Feeders may have a higher initial investment compared to simpler feeding systems, the long-term savings in labor and operational costs often justify the expense. Buyers should analyze the total cost of ownership, which includes installation, maintenance, and energy efficiency. Additionally, manufacturers that provide comprehensive after-sales support and warranty services should be prioritized, as this ensures that any potential issues can be swiftly addressed, minimizing disruption to production.
